The most recent safety standards for fire detection, signaling, and emergency communications are laid out in NFPA 72.

While it primarily focuses on fire alarm systems, the Code also covers mass notification systems designed for emergencies such as severe weather, terrorist threats, biological, chemical, and nuclear incidents, and other potential hazards.
